- Canton Commercial Advertiser
Tuesday, August 25, 1942
Stephen Van Sant, Russell Farmer, Passes
Stephen Van Sant, a native of the town of DeKalb but long time resident of the town of Russell, passed away at 9:30 Wednesday night at the home of Harry Niles, South Russell, where he had made his home. Funeral services were conducted Saturday at 2 p.m. at the South Russell Community Church, the Rev. Raymond Downs, pastor of the DeGrasse Presbyterian Church, officiating. Burial was made in South Russell Cemetery.
Mr. Van Sant was born in DeKalb on April 1, 1866, a son of Richard and Joanna Collins Van Sant. Early in life he married Miss Eva Lane, who died several years ago.
There remain, a brother, Joseph Van Sant of DeGrasse; an adopted daughter, Mrs. Frank (Blanche) Premo of Gouverneur and several nieces and nephews.
